你查询的IP:[119.128.89.157]  地理位置:中国–广东–东莞

最新查询116.116.43.113 221.208.141.105 119.253.150.14 120.80.240.53 114.60.143.125 58.144.166.121 124.47.170.169 116.224.54.153 124.66.114.201 119.128.89.157 203.176.168.66 203.91.32.33 203.208.90.199 124.126.26.53 124.196.167.75 222.168.3.52 202.127.208.143 210.25.152.25 123.49.128.248 124.240.118.151 117.103.16.236 124.72.185.182 119.58.99.108 202.96.133.132 203.190.96.254 125.58.128.174 59.151.48.232 123.137.195.124 210.2.229.119 118.230.248.68 202.38.150.21